Landing page builders create online pages designed to entice a user to take a specific action such as signing up or making a purchase. It's one of the primary ways to capture online leads and connect with prospects. There are many landing page builders out there requiring little-to-no code and offering basic to advanced features. The best overall landing page builder is free while providing premium upgrades for larger companies.
HubSpot Marketing Hub’s landing page builder tops our list thanks to its suite of free features and drag-and-drop editor that allows individuals to create a page in minutes. HubSpot’s free builder is a great choice for small businesses that already use HubSpot CRM since it pulls data from the CRM to deliver personalized content for visitors. As your business scales, upgrade from $45 a month for unlimited pages and no HubSpot branding.
Leadpages ofters a landing page and lead capture form builder with unlimited traffic and leads for a low price.
Leadpages is a solid landing page builder offering unlimited traffic and leads for all its tiers. The lowest tier starts at $37 per month and offers landing pages, popups, and alert bars, but you can upgrade for advanced features like A/B split testing. It's advanced features are more limited than other options, however, making it best for those needing a basic builder that can scale for an inexpensive price.
Unbounce features an intuitive editor along with machine learning to help drive conversions and track visitor habits.
Unbounce’s user-friendly visual editor makes it easy for anyone to launch a landing page in no time. Drag and drop text, images, and widgets where you want them (you can preview your edits right before publishing). Meanwhile, under the hood is "Smart Traffic," an AI-powered optimization tool that directs visitors to pages where they’re most likely to convert. Smart Traffic takes the place of manual A/B testing; just set a conversion goal and the AI will handle the rest.
Freshsales offers a suite of sales and marketing features that includes a landing pag builder and a free tier.
Freshsales Suite is a sales CRM from Freshworks that includes a solid mix of sales and marketing features. In addition to sales pipeline features like deal and contact management, Freshsales Suite offers a landing page and form builder that integrates with your sales tools so your team can follow up with leads. The number of total landing pages you can create is limited, however, with only five in the Growth tier and 25 in Enterprise.
For the most sales features, you can also check out their Freshsales CRM which offers advanced sals tools as well as a form builder, but lacks landing page capabilities.
Entrepreneurs who are willing to pay a premium for an easy way to build viable sales funnels will find value in ClickFunnels.
ClickFunnels is geared toward entrepreneurs who want to build a viable sales funnel that they can automate for conversions. Users can create a drag-and-drop funnel featuring a landing page, sales page, upsell page, thank you page, membership area, and more. ClickFunnels is one of the pricier landing page builders on this list, but many business owners report that the step-by-step funnel approach has yielded an increase in lead generation and conversions, so it may pay for itself in the long run.
Instapage offers a single-tier landing page builder with unlimited page as well as advanced analytics and optimizations.
Instapage is an advanced landing page builder offering single-tier pricing and unlimited domains, landing pages, and conversions. While it may be the priciest on our list, it offers advanced features such as sophisticated A/B testing, heat mapping, customizations, reporting, and more. It also offers basic form building, however, you may find the forms limited and they don't offer popups.
